### Deploybot 1.8.0

Deploybot now posts deploy status to channels automatically instead of waiting for someone to ask it. Added the `/rollbackwatch` command, fixed the thing where it announced the same canary twice, and it finally knows the difference between staging and prod (sorry about last Tuesday). Config moved to `botconf.yml` — old env vars still work but are deprecated. Maintainer going forward is listed below.

approver of faduf-bagug = Framir Sorwyn

**Q: How do I get into the spare hardware store?**

Room B-14, lower corridor past the Quillon server closet. Night shift may pull keyboards, cables, and loaner laptops only — no monitors without a ticket. Log every item on the clipboard inside the door. Door auto-locks; don't wedge it. Faulty gear goes on the red shelf, tagged. If the reader flashes amber twice, wait ten seconds and retry. Enter with the code below.

turnstile pass: bdg-YPPQB-52010

Handover — spare parts, Keldmoor relay site

From: Dace. To: Orla.

Two crates of pump seals and the replacement valve assembly ship Tuesday with Fennick Haulage. Keldmoor road is gated after 16:00, so morning delivery only. Check crate seals on arrival; photograph any damage before unloading. Manifest is taped inside the lid of crate 1. Courier hand-over instruction is below.

handover note for yagef-bagep: the drudor pelius courier leaves the kasdor zorvan norir ledger at gate 8016 under passcode 755406

Subject: Weekend lift maintenance — Corven House

All,

Lifts A and B are offline Saturday 07:00 to Sunday 14:00 for cable inspection. Direct staff to the east stairwell. Goods lift remains live for deliveries only — book slots via the desk log. The stairwell fire door will be alarmed but unlocked; the service corridor door stays locked. Use the override code below if access is needed.

turnstile pass: bdg-JBCWS-7

Changelog 2.9.0 — Crumbline defaults changed. Order cutoff for next-day bakery fulfillment moved from 22:00 to 18:00 store-local; late orders now roll to the following slot instead of rejecting. On-call: alerts referencing the old cutoff will fire once during rollout — ack and suppress, do not roll back. Capacity checks now run at cutoff, not midnight. The new default values shipped with this release are listed below.

settings of bawif-fawif:
ralix:
  log_level: warn
  metrics_host: metrics.ralix.tolvaqsys.internal
  pool_size: 32